excel怎么运算文本

excel怎么运算文本

一、EXCEL中文本运算的核心技巧

在Excel中,运算文本的方法包括:使用函数、结合引用与运算符、利用文本函数进行转换。其中,最常用的方法是使用函数,如CONCATENATETEXTLEFTRIGHT等。利用这些函数可以将文本进行拼接、提取、转换,从而实现对文本的运算。

详细来说,使用CONCATENATE函数可以将多个文本单元格拼接成一个新的文本单元格;TEXT函数可以将数值转换为文本,并按指定格式显示;LEFTRIGHT等函数则可以从文本中提取指定长度的子字符串。这些函数组合使用,可以满足大部分文本运算需求。

二、使用函数进行文本运算

CONCATENATE函数

CONCATENATE函数用于将多个文本单元格合并为一个文本单元格。例如,如果你有两个单元格A1和B1分别包含文本"Hello"和"World",你可以使用公式=CONCATENATE(A1, " ", B1)来生成新的文本"Hello World"。

TEXT函数

TEXT函数用于将数值转换为文本,并按指定格式显示。例如,如果单元格A1包含数值12345.678,你可以使用公式=TEXT(A1, "0.00")将其转换为文本"12345.68"。

LEFT和RIGHT函数

LEFTRIGHT函数用于从文本中提取指定长度的子字符串。例如,如果单元格A1包含文本"Hello World",你可以使用公式=LEFT(A1, 5)提取前5个字符,得到"Hello";使用公式=RIGHT(A1, 5)提取后5个字符,得到"World"。

三、引用与运算符结合

在Excel中,可以通过引用单元格和使用运算符来进行文本运算。例如,使用&运算符可以将多个文本单元格合并为一个文本单元格,而不需要使用CONCATENATE函数。例如,如果你有两个单元格A1和B1分别包含文本"Hello"和"World",你可以使用公式=A1 & " " & B1来生成新的文本"Hello World"。

四、利用文本函数进行转换

UPPER、LOWER和PROPER函数

UPPER函数用于将文本转换为全大写字母,LOWER函数用于将文本转换为全小写字母,PROPER函数用于将文本的每个单词的首字母转换为大写。例如,如果单元格A1包含文本"hello world",你可以使用公式=UPPER(A1)将其转换为"HELLO WORLD";使用公式=LOWER(A1)将其转换为"hello world";使用公式=PROPER(A1)将其转换为"Hello World"。

SUBSTITUTE函数

SUBSTITUTE函数用于替换文本中的指定子字符串。例如,如果单元格A1包含文本"Hello World",你可以使用公式=SUBSTITUTE(A1, "World", "Excel")将其转换为"Hello Excel"。

五、总结

在Excel中,运算文本的方法主要包括使用函数、结合引用与运算符、利用文本函数进行转换。通过灵活运用这些方法,可以实现对文本的各种运算需求。具体来说,CONCATENATE函数用于合并文本,TEXT函数用于格式化文本,LEFTRIGHT函数用于提取子字符串,UPPERLOWERPROPER函数用于转换大小写,SUBSTITUTE函数用于替换子字符串。通过这些方法的组合使用,可以满足大部分文本运算需求。

相关问答FAQs:

1. 在Excel中如何将文本进行运算?

  • 问题: 如何在Excel中对文本进行运算?
  • 回答: 在Excel中,可以使用一些函数和操作符来对文本进行运算。例如,可以使用CONCATENATE函数将多个文本串连接在一起,使用LEN函数计算文本的长度,使用LEFT和RIGHT函数截取文本的左边和右边部分,使用MID函数从文本中提取指定位置的字符等等。

2. 如何在Excel中对包含数字和文本的单元格进行运算?

  • 问题: 当单元格中既包含数字又包含文本时,如何在Excel中进行运算?
  • 回答: 如果单元格中包含数字和文本,可以使用Excel的文本函数和数值函数来进行运算。可以使用IF函数来判断单元格中的内容,然后根据条件进行运算。也可以使用VALUE函数将文本转换为数值,然后进行数值运算。

3. 如何在Excel中使用公式对文本进行计算?

  • 问题: 在Excel中,如何使用公式对文本进行计算?
  • 回答: 在Excel中,可以使用公式对文本进行计算。例如,可以使用SUM函数对包含数字的文本进行求和,使用AVERAGE函数计算包含数字的文本的平均值,使用COUNT函数计算包含数字的文本的数量等等。可以根据具体的需求选择合适的公式进行计算。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4708173

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部